For some embedded devices, we need reduce code size and data
footprint as much as possible, e.g. disabling procfs, hw/sw
params refinement, mmap, dpcm, dapm, compressed API...

Here add root config menu for those configuration, and
disable procfs once reduced memory footprint is selected.

+menuconfig SND_REDUCED_MEMORY_FOOTPRINT
+       bool "Reduced Memory Footprint Support"
+       default n
+       help
+         Say 'Y' to enable Reduced Memory Footprint Support, which may
+         reduce code size and data footprint as much as possible.
+
+config SND_PROC_FS
+       bool "Sound Proc FS Support" if SND_REDUCED_MEMORY_FOOTPRINT
+       depends on PROC_FS
+       default y
+       help
+         Say 'N' to disable Sound proc FS, which may reduce code size about
+         9KB on x86_64 platform.
+         If unsure say Y.
